Output 87fd8fb5ddafc2aeacff813431b61eaffe01f1f1876ac60a496d5d7736309538:2

value
342000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86de540c564b322ab2ae8383aa69b017845130a7 OP_EQUAL
address
3Dz8otdkC8Mi36CDCpHaGdpEAb21DFwQF4
transaction
87fd8fb5ddafc2aeacff813431b61eaffe01f1f1876ac60a496d5d7736309538
confirmations
361659
spent
true